On filters...what does it mean NO - NC??
What's the difference between normally open & normally closed?
Jerry
from Pennsylvania
November 17, 2015
Answer
It's referring to the status of the drain. An "N.O." drain remains open when it's not activated; an "N.C." drain is normally closed when it's not activated.
This allows flexibility in your filter setup. Normally open drains help prevent problems caused by freezing since the condensate doesn't build up.
For both NO and NC SMC drains the drain can be discharged manually by turning the drain cock to the "O" position.
